Role Description – Sunday School Superintendent

This form is to be completed by Sunday School Superintendents in the PCV

Aim:

As a Sunday School Superintendent, you aim to:

Encourage and support the Sunday School teachers

Exhort the Sunday School teachers to teach the Bible faithfully and truthfully

Encourage and pray for Sunday School teachers and children

Responsibilities:

You are directly responsible to __________________________________________ [the Session and Minister]

Responsibilities include:

Appointing Sunday School teachers with the approval of Session, except in the case where Session directly appoints teachers

Selecting teaching material and submitting it to Session for approval

Making reports to Session about the Sunday School

Planning and implementing the Sunday School programme, delegating tasks as appropriate to Sunday School teachers

Being available to parents for answering queries about the Sunday School

Ensuring all Sunday School teachers hold current Victorian Working With Children Checks, are registered with the SCU and have undertaken to complete Safe Church Basic Training and the Online Refresher Course

Role Requirements:

You must:

Hold a current Victorian Working With Children Check card and provided the card number to the Session and the SCU

Be a member of the church or if not a member have been minuted in session records as an accepted Sunday School Superintendent

Have received and read the Safe Church Policy and Code of Conduct and have committed to act in accordance with these documents

Undertaken or agreed to undertake the Safe Church Basic Training Course and the Online Refresher Course

If new to this role, completed an Initial Registration Form, provided two referees and agreed to undergo screening and reference checks

Sign this role description as an indication of your acceptance of the responsibilities of the role

General Information:

It is important that all activities of the Sunday School are open to observation by the Minister, the Session and parents.

If you are training up younger leaders, it is important to pastorally care for them. When delegating tasks to them, it is important to work along side with them in the organising and implementing of the specific tasks.

Having an accessible first aid kit for the Sunday School is essential.

Child Protection Protocols for this role:

All children and others under your leadership, regardless of age, are covered by these protocols. Note: They do not replace the Safe Church Policy or Code of Conduct. Rather they are intended to provide helpful general protective protocol advice.

Do not allow yourself to be in any area alone with a child. Always have another teacher or the parent with you.

If a leader or child of the opposite sex comes to you for counselling, if possible take them to a fellow leader of the same sex as a person who can talk to them. It is preferable to counsel or talk through issues with a child or a leader of the same sex

If a child or teacher of the same sex comes to you for counselling, ensure you do so in an open area, never a closed room

If you should need to speak to a child or teacher about participating or helping out in a Sunday School session, ensure you do so in the vicinity of other people, with another teacher present

If a child is distressed and needs to be consoled, it is important that a person of the same gender does the consoling. Ensure that another teacher is with you at all times, and use your discretion when speaking and comforting the child

If a child or teacher discloses information to you regarding any kind of abuse or neglect, or you have concerns about these issues in relation to a child, you must pass on this information to the Session or Minister and then to the Safe Church Unit. However, be careful not to reveal this confidence to any other person

If a child or teacher discloses information to you regarding any kind of abuse or behaviour by a teacher or person in authority in the church which breaches the Safe Church Code of Conduct contact the Safe Church Unit – 0499 090 449.

Remember: the following forms are to be completed and forwarded to the SCU when a new person

applies to work with children under 18 in any capacity in the PCV – including in a voluntary capacity

1. Initial Registration with the SCU form

2. Signed copy of the Role Description form

3. Confidential Record of reference checks form

4. Evidence of holding a current Victorian Working With Children Check (ideally a photocopy of

the Working With Children Check card)

The SCU completes the screening procedure and will notify once the applicant is approved or not

approved.

A person can only commence in a role working with children under 18 in the PCV once the SCU has

notified the congregation/organisation of the approval.
